#e74988 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e74988 is composed of 90.6% red, 28.6%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.4% magenta, 41.1%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 336.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 59.6%. #e74988 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#cf0011.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

Shades and Tints of #e74988

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090104 is the darkest color, while #fef6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e74988

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a09096 is the less saturated color, while #ff3183 is the most saturated one.
